Science Behind the Calculator

This tool is based on exercise physiology and physics principles.

1. Calories Burned Formula (MET-Based)

Calories per minute=MET×3.5×Weight200Calories\ per\ minute = \frac{MET \times 3.5 \times Weight}{200}Calories per minute=200MET×3.5×Weight​

Where:

  • MET = 8 (moderate intensity push-ups)
  • Weight = body weight in pounds

2. Total Calories Burned

Total Calories=Calories per minute×DurationTotal\ Calories = Calories\ per\ minute \times DurationTotal Calories=Calories per minute×Duration

This calculates total energy spent during the workout.


3. Work Done (Physics-Based Estimate)

Work=Weight×9.81×Reps×0.5Work = Weight \times 9.81 \times Reps \times 0.5Work=Weight×9.81×Reps×0.5

Where:

  • 9.81 = gravitational acceleration
  • 0.5 = approximate vertical displacement factor

Understanding MET Value in Push-Ups

MET (Metabolic Equivalent of Task) represents exercise intensity.

  • Light activity: 2–4 MET
  • Moderate activity: 5–7 MET
  • Push-ups: ~8 MET

This means push-ups are considered a high-intensity bodyweight exercise, making them excellent for fat burning and muscle building.


Example Calculation

Let’s understand the calculator with a real example.

Given:

  • Body Weight = 160 lbs
  • Push-Up Reps = 30
  • Duration = 10 minutes
  • MET = 8

Step 1: Calories per Minute

Calories per minute = (8 × 3.5 × 160) ÷ 200
= 22.4 kcal/min


Step 2: Total Calories Burned

22.4 × 10 = 224 kcal


Step 3: Work Done

Work = 160 × 9.81 × 30 × 0.5
= 23544 J (approx.)


Final Result:

  • Calories Burned: 224 kcal
  • Calories per Minute: 22.4 kcal/min
  • Work Done: 23544 Joules

Limitations of the Calculator

Although very useful, the tool has some limitations:

  • Does not measure real-time heart rate
  • Uses average MET values (not personalized)
  • Work calculation is an approximation
  • Does not consider body composition differences

Still, it provides a highly reliable estimate for general fitness tracking.
